Trivia about the song Someone to Hold by 112

When was the song “Someone to Hold” released by 112?
The song Someone to Hold was released in 1997, on the album “Room 112”.
Who composed the song “Someone to Hold” by 112?
The song “Someone to Hold” by 112 was composed by ARNOLD HENNINGS, G. COLLINS, DARON JONES, MICHAEL KEITH, QUINNES PARKER, MICHAEL SCANDRICK, L. MAXWELL.
